Chestnut Creek Wetlands Natural Area Preserve

Chestnut Creek Wetlands Natural Area Preserve is a 244-acre Natural Area Preserve located in , , United States. Local wetlands support several rare species, while the upland slopes support northern hardwoods including beech, birch, and maple.
